Инструменты программиста
14.2K subscribers
1.44K photos
106 videos
4 files
1.65K links
Полезные инструменты для программистов — бесплатные и платные

Разместить рекламу: @tproger_sales_bot

Правила общения: https://tprg.ru/rules

Другие каналы: @tproger_channels

Регистрация в перечне РКН: https://tprg.ru/mX0S
Download Telegram
Куда идти работать в это сложное время? iFellow ищет 600 новых IT-специалистов

Ищут сотрудников поддержки, аналитиков, разработчиков, тестировщиков, DevOps-инженеров и других IT-специалистов для работы с крупнейшими экосистемами Сбера, ВТБ, Альфа-Групп, Газпром, ФСК и др. Центральный офис находится в Москве, филиалы работают в Воронеже, Саратове, Новосибирске, Екатеринбурге и Томске, а сотрудников принимают во всех регионах.

Будут рады как опытным специалистам, так и начинающим — новичков обучают и выдают сертификат государственного образца.

Узнать подробнее о компании и найти вакансию для себя: https://tprg.ru/RwK6

#вакансии #работа
gitignore.io — удобный инструмент для генерации файлов .gitignore

На главной странице сервиса достаточно ввести используемые в проекте технологии, после чего он мгновенно создаст подходящий .gitignore-файл.

Сам проект опенсорсный, его исходники лежат в открытом доступе на GitHub.

Стоимость: #бесплатно.

#git
CSS Scan — расширение для браузера, которое лишит смысла постоянное использование “inspect element”.

С его помощью можно получить информацию о CSS любого элемента на странице. Для этого достаточно навести на него курсор мыши.

Инструмент также позволяет скопировать все правила CSS элемента одним щелчком мыши.

Стоимость: $110 (но до 22 марта 37%-скидка, поэтому цена снижена до $69)

#CSS #веб #расширение
SymbolHound — поисковая система, которая будет особенно полезна разработчикам

Её отличительной особенностью является то, что она не игнорирует специальные символы. Это означает, что вы можете легко использовать в поисковом запросе такие символы как &, % и π.

Это особенно полезно, когда приходится искать полезную информацию по различным языкам программирования и фреймворка.

Стоимость: #бесплатно

#поиск
DeskPinsутилита для закрепления отдельных окон поверх всех остальных

С её помощью можно сделать так, чтобы определённые окна всегда оставались на виду. Для этого достаточно взять «булавку» с иконки DeskPins в системном трее и нажать на любое окно.

Работает на Windows, начиная с версии Windows 9X.

Стоимость: #бесплатно

#утилита #windows
This media is not supported in your browser
VIEW IN TELEGRAM
Flourish — удобный визуализатор различной информации

Наверное, практически каждый из нас видел видео, где демонстрируется изменение популярности смартфонов, марок еды и т.д. от года к году.

Именно для таких и множества других целей используется Flourish. С помощью сервиса можно выбрать один из множества разных шаблонов для визуализации: от простых лайн и бар-чартов до более сложных форматов в виде историй.

Стоимость: #бесплатно (но для работы целых команд требуется оплатить использование, связавшись с разработчиками сервиса по электронной почте)

#графики #данные
This media is not supported in your browser
VIEW IN TELEGRAM
Clumsy — инструмент для значительного ухудшения состояние вашей сети в Windows

При этом весь процесс происходит под вашим контролем и в интерактивным режиме. Это может быть полезно, если вы хотите отследить странные ошибки, связанные с неработающей сетью, или оценить работу вашего приложения в условиях плохого соединения.

Стоимость: #бесплатно

#сеть #windows
Hoppscotch — это лёгкий и основанный на веб-технологиях пакет для разработки API

В отличие от ряда конкурентов, инструмент бесплатен. Ещё одно его преимущество — открытый исходный код, доступ к которому можно получить на GitHub-странице проекта.

Hoppscotch был создан с нуля с учётом простоты использования и доступности, обеспечивая всю необходимую функциональность для разработчиков API с минималистичным и ненавязчивым пользовательским интерфейсом.

Стоимость: #бесплатно

#API #веб
Rectangle — это приложение для управления окнами, созданное для пользователей macOS

Чаще всего разработчики используют горячие клавиши IDE, чтобы ускорить процесс разработки. Того же можно добиться, управляя размерами и расположением окон при помощи клавиатуры, а не мыши.

Ещё одним плюсом утилиты является глубокий уровень кастомизации — любителям поковыряться в менюшках понравится.

Стоимость: #бесплатно

#утилита #macOS
Darling — инструмент для запуска macOS-приложений на Linux

Звучит как Wine, да. И по своей сути, чем-то подобным утилита и является. Только если Wine — это про запуск Windows-приложений на Linux, то Darling — про запуск macOS-софта.

Проект с открытым исходным кодом, так что любой желающий может с ним ознакомиться и даже внести свои изменения.

Стоимость: #бесплатно

#linux #macOS
Kinto.shинструмент, облегчающий переход с macOS на другие ОС

С помощью этой небольшой утилитки можно сделать так, что горячие клавиши с macOS будут работать на Windows и Linux.

Стоимость: #бесплатно

#windows #macOS #linux #утилита
Swimlanes.io — инструмент для создания диаграмм и схем при помощи markdown

Вместо того, чтобы использовать различные тяжёлые программы, разработчики Swimlanes предлагают вспомнить знакомый многим язык разметки.

Получившийся результат можно сохранить в виде png-картинки или pdf-файла.

Стоимость: #бесплатно

#markdown #диаграммы #утилита
This media is not supported in your browser
VIEW IN TELEGRAM
aretext — минималистичный текстовый редактор с совместимой с vim привязкой клавиш

Приложение поддерживает около 100 наиболее распространенных команд vim в обычном, вставном и визуальном режимах.

На данный момент проект находится в бета-режиме. Но все основные функции уже реализованы и редактором можно пользоваться в качестве основного инструмента.

Стоимость: #бесплатно

#vim #текстовый_редактор
DevToys — швейцарский армейский нож для разработчиков

Приложение помогает в таких повседневных задачах разработчиков, как форматирование JSON, сравнение текста, тестирование RegExp.

При этом используя DevToys, больше не нужно использовать множество сервисов для выполнения простых задач с вашими данными.

Стоимость: #бесплатно

#веб #json #html
Guake — Linux-терминал в стиле легендарной Quake

Помните, как в Quake (и прочих играх на движке id Tech) можно было открыть консоль для ввода чит-кодов? Теперь такой дизайн Терминала появился и на Linux.

Открывается Guake Terminal по нажатию F12.

Стоимость: #бесплатно

#терминал #linux
ShortcutNinja — инструмент для управления всеми сочетаниями клавиш ваших IDE в одном месте

Утилита способна самостоятельно определять установленные среды разработки — пользователю не нужно прикладывать к этому никаких усилий.

Стоимость: #бесплатно

#IDE #vscode #jetbrains #sublime
Devdocs.io — документация по API для всех популярных языков программирования

Один сервис объединяет разную документацию по API. Из интересных функций: мгновенный поиск для поиска любого фрагмента кода.

Инструмент можно использовать в том числе в автономном режиме.

Стоимость: #бесплатно

#API
Codeply — сервис, помогающий облегчить жизнь веб-разработчика

Он представляет из себя быстрый и бесплатный онлайн-редактор, включающий десятки фреймворков, стартовых шаблонов и более 50 000 фрагментов кода.

Codeplay может помочь создать адаптивные макеты с помощью Bootstrap. Он также имеет инструменты SemanticUI и CSS, которые важны для разработки интерфейса.

Стоимость: #бесплатно

#веб #CSS
Bundlephobia — простой способ узнать о влиянии на производительность вашего приложения включения пакета npm

С помощью этого инструмента можно не только загружать различные пакеты в реестре NPM, но также и свой файл package.json. Благодаря этой функции можно сканировать все зависимости в вашем проекте.

Стоимость: #бесплатно

#npm #json #веб
Regexr — онлайн-сервис для проверки регулярных выражений

Главной особенностью инструмента является его способность работать прямо в браузере. Поддерживаемых языков два: JavaScript и PHP/PCRE.

Из интересного можно отметить, что Regexr умеет объяснять, что означает та или иная часть регулярного выражения.

Стоимость: #бесплатно

#js #php #веб